In electron capture, an inner atomic electron is captured by a proton in the nucleus, transforming it into a neutron, and an electron neutrino is released. Electron capture is the predominant mode of decay for neutron deficient nuclei whose atomic number is greater than 80. ![]() ![]() ![]() When a nucleus undergoes electron capture reaction, its mass number doesn’t change but atomic number decreases by one. Radioactive decay plays a central role in planetary sciences as appropriate decay schemes are used to date geological and astronomical processes and radioactivity provides an important source of heat in planetary bodies, both in their early history during accretion and differentiation and also over geological times.
